使用lightbox和AJAX的Rcarousel(调用PHP页面)

时间:2013-06-18 21:44:57

标签: jquery ajax widget lightbox carousel

我正在使用该网站提供的Lightbox插件Rcarousel(http://ryrych.github.io/rcarousel/),并且所有默认设置都可以正常工作。我已将其修改为使用Ajax,以便用户可以从多个图像(这是指向不同图库的链接)中进行选择,然后使用ajax调用来加载轮播。这在大多数情况下都有效。在加载时,我有一个被调用的图像,所有图像都加载,旋转木马和灯箱完美运行。 我的问题是当我点击一个图像,然后加载新的图库时,只有默认可见的轮播中的图片(选项>可见:4)适用于灯箱,其余只是链接到图像本身。这就像新的图像不是旋转木马的一部分,但它看起来就像它在火炬中看到它时的效果。

declareLightbox();
function declareLightbox() {
    $( ".lb_gallery" ).rlightbox();
}

declareCarousel();
function declareCarousel() {
    $( "#carousel" ).rcarousel({
    auto: {enabled: false},
    start: generatePages,
    visible: 4,
    pageLoaded: pageLoaded,
    width: 160,
    height: 120,
    margin:20
});

我不得不修改控制它的脚本,将声明放在函数内部,以便我可以在Ajax成功调用中再次调用它们,并且它似乎对旋转木马工作正常。我需要为灯箱调用其他东西,还是我完全错过了其他东西?

感谢

0 个答案:

没有答案